On , OSHA opened a planned safety inspection of 595 CONSTRUCTION LLC in 1501 COLLINS DR, ELBURN, IL 60119 (NAICS 238350). OSHA activity number 347473605.

What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R  1926.501(b)(13):"Residential construction." Each employee eng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els shall be prot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system unless another provision in paragraph (b) of this section provides for an alternative fall protection measure.   The employer does not protect each employee required to work from elevations during residential construction activities 6 feet or more above lower levels by providing and ensuring the use gu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, or providing alternative fall protection measures under provisions of paragraph 1926.501(b):   (a): This most recently occurred on or about May 10, 2024, at 1501 Collins Drive, Elburn, Illinois. Employees are exposed to falls of approximately 11.8 feet or more above ground level while engaged in residential construction activities. Fall protection was not being utilized while performing construction work on the second level.  (b): This most recently occurred on or about May 10, 2024, at 1501 Collins Drive, Elburn, Illinois. Employees are exposed to falls of approximately 20.5 feet or more through holes while engaged in residential construction activities. Fall protection was not being utilized while performing construction work on the second level.  595 Construction LLC was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ard, 29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13), which was contained in OSHA inspection number 1595058, citation number 1, item number 1, and was affirmed as a final order on 11-01-2022, with respect to a workplace located at 15917 W Orchid Lane, Lockport, IL 60441.  595 Construction LLC was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ard, 29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13), which was contained in OSHA inspection number 1684870, citation number 2, item number 1, and was affirmed as a final order on 10-19-2023, with respect to a workplace located at Lot 5016 S. Longcommon Lane, Plainfield, IL 60586.

29 CFR  1926.503(b)(1): The employer shall verify compliance with paragraph (a) of this section by preparing a written certification record. The written certification record shall contain the name or other identity of the employee trained, the date(s) of the training, and the signature of the person who conducted the training or the signature of the employer. If the employer relies on training conducted by another employer or completed prior to the effective date of this section, the certification record shall indicate the date the employer determined the prior training was adequate rather than the date of actual training.  (a): On or about May 10, 2024, employees were exposed to fall hazards while performing roofing work and the employer did not certify that employees had been trained to recognize fall hazards, and the procedure to be followed in order to minimize those hazards.  595 Construction LLC was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ard, 29 CFR 1926.503(b)(1), which was contained in OSHA inspection number 1595058, citation number 2, item number 1, and was affirmed as a final order on 11-01-2022, with respect to a workplace located at 15917 W Orchid Lane, Lockport, IL 60441.  Abatement documentation is required of this item in accordance with the requirements of 29 CFR 1903.19(d).
